六欲四禪

Pronunciations

Basic Meaning: six desire heavens and four meditation heavens

Senses:

  • the six desire heavens 六欲天 where sexual desire continues, and the four dhyāna heavens 四禪天 of purity above them free from such desire. 〔能顯中邊慧日論 T 1863.45.444b24〕 [Charles Muller; source(s): Nakamura, Soothill]
